5 Awesome Photo Editing Tips You Need to Know

 

Close up of a woman taking photo of fruits in a bowl using a mobile phone for her food blog. Blogger capturing photo of a fruit bowl placed beside a camera and a flower pot.

There are a lot of reasons why photography is one of the most popular hobbies in the 21st century. From enhanced photo technology to popular photo-sharing platforms, photography is accessible and fun to explore.

If you’re looking for ways to improve your photography skills, it’s time to think about what happens after the photo is taken. The way that you edit images isn’t quite as important as the way you capture images in the first place, but it’s pretty close.

We’ve compiled some photo editing tips that are easy to follow and don’t require expensive software.

Read on for five pieces of great photo editing advice that you’re going to want to put to use ASAP.

1. Start With Your Best Photos

Whether you’re a pro or a hobbyist, you’re probably snapping multiple shots of your subject. This is a good impulse because it means that you can sort the great from the just-okay. When you’re practicing editing, keep in mind that no amount of editing will turn a subpar photo into a great photo.

2. Make Adjustments to Shadows and Highlights

One of our simplest photo editing tips is to tweak the shadows and highlights in your photos. Shadow and highlight edits impact how bright or dark these elements of your photo are. By playing around with these two elements, you can make your photos closer to what we see with our eyes, rather than just what the camera captures.

3. Adjust What You’ve Captured

Some professional photographers take great pride in the fact that they never crop their photos or edit out unwanted elements. The reality is that there’s nothing wrong with adjusting what you’ve captured so that your subject is the primary focus. Using tools like this background remover can enhance your photos and allow your vision to come to life.

4. Learn From Your Favorite Filters

We all use preset filters sometimes and we can actually learn a thing or two about what we’re drawn to by paying closer attention to the filters we gravitate towards. For example, are they making your photo cooler or warmer? By studying filters, we can learn to make more subtle edits on our own.

5. Resist the Urge to Over-Edit

Keep in mind that when you edit images, the goal is to enhance what’s there, not overshadow it. A lot of great photos are lost to things like over-saturation, which can make a photo of something real look like a digital rendering. A good rule of thumb is to edit only to the point that your photo looks, well, unedited.

Which Photo Editing Tips Will You Try First?

Photography is a great hobby in part because it’s easy and fun to learn new tricks. These photo editing tips will help you to enhance your photography without expensive software. Which tips will you try?
